Creole Ticket #759: Unable to insert a literal "|" in a table.

The following creole code should format as a two-column table ...

|=column1   |=column2                         | 
|           | <eucode>puts(1, "~|" )</eucode> | 

When creole is fixed the table below should be formatted correctly.
